Took a shot at AG Andrew Cuomo’s recent presentations on how overtime in final years systematically boost veteran public employees’ pensions: “Some are going around saying let’s re-identify the problem. I’m saying let’s come up with a solution.” He cited cops in Suffolk sometimes making $200,000 and full-salary disability deals.
- Related Cuomo’s status of being an AG with high polling and flush financing as so similar it is “eerie” to that of Eliot Spitzer in 2006, but insisted again that voters are looking for his fiscal skill-set this time in the governor’s race.
- Challenged Cuomo to say, rather than cite a crackdown “on some charity or something like that,” what in his background qualifies him as a tax-cutter. “These other candidates,” Levy said, are reluctant to “chip away” at special interest support.
- Repeated his warning that the pension system is on the verge of imploding and cited some 401k recipients are guaranteed an 8 percent rate of return regardless of the market, assured by the pension system.
- Called for elmination of “mandatory arbitration” in public employee contracting.
- Argued it is irrational to close upstate prisons while requiring localities to build jails as major capital projects.
- Opposed the removal of Empire Zones, attributing development gains to them.
- Called his support for redistricting reform an essential ethics plank.

Even if it was widely expected, Steve Levy gets a public boost today with the endorsement of Phil Ragusa, the chairman of the Queens Republican committee, who'd attended Levy's candidacy announcement in Battery Americana 2xuAmericana 2xuAmericana 2xuAmericana 2xu last month. Queens carries the sixth highest weighted vote of the state's 62 counties, and the support of Ragusa and his executive committee, by one well-informed estimate, probably gets Levy close to 3 percent of the weighted convention vote out of the nearly 4 percent that the borough carries overall
